The Lumberjack and the Sawmill Jill

A Standalone Small Town Mountain Man Romance with a Curvy Heroine

He’s been waiting for her for years.
She never knew he was watching.

Kelly McCrae is having a pretty crap year.
Her cheating ex drains their accounts, steals the minivan—and their son’s college fund—then leaves her to face the whispers alone.
Apparently being plump and over forty makes it her fault.
But Leonard J.T. Lawrence has never overlooked Kelly.
Born and raised in Woodhaven, he built his empire from mountain grit and iron will. Powerful. Controlled. Used to getting what he wants.
And what he’s wanted for years? Was never money.
Now she’s free—and he’s done waiting.
Kelly is fire wrapped in softness. Steel beneath curves.
But when her ex makes a play that threatens her son, J.T. offers the one thing she’s never had—protection.
He’s not offering sympathy. He’s offering himself.
But Kelly won’t be rescued unless it’s on her terms.
If J.T. wants her, he’ll have to prove he’s not just another man trying to control her world.
Powerful tycoon. Fierce single mom. One custody battle. One indecent proposal. One mountain strong enough for love.
